The MOST important aspect of the Monroe Doctrine (1823) was that it

Answer:   showed the US backed the independence of Latin America.

Explanation:

The United States was still young at the time the Monroe Doctrine was declared, and did not have a powerful navy to be patrolling the South American coast at that time.  But the US did want to keep European powers from encroaching into the Western Hemisphere, and wanted to put Europe on notice to that effect.  

President James Monroe asserted the doctrine in his annual address to Congress in 1823.  The doctrine was that the US would not interfere in European affairs, but also would view any attempts by European powers to take control of any nation in the Western Hemisphere as a hostile act against the United States.

As reported by the US Office of the Historian, there were some additional motives in mind in the US position, in addition to backing the independence of Latin American nations.  "Monroe’s administration forewarned the imperial European powers against interfering in the affairs of the newly independent Latin American states or potential United States territories. While Americans generally objected to European colonies in the New World, they also desired to increase United States influence and trading ties throughout the region to their south."

Which u.s. naval leader commanded amphibious assaults on italy and southern france?
serious [3.7K]
The correct answer is <span>Admiral H. Kent Hewitt
</span>Admiral Hewitt was put in charge of the naval forces when World War II broke out. He was charged with c<span>oordinating the action of warships and dive-bombers,whereby he won the decisive battle off Casablanca in 1942. </span><span> He commanded similar successful operations with the landings on Sicily, Salerno and in southern France</span>
